How they compare

Mauritius currently reports -0.2978 against -0.3223 in Rwanda, a difference of 0.0245.

Across all 7 years both countries report, Mauritius has been ahead every year.

Mauritius ranks 36th and Rwanda ranks 38th of 66 countries.

Mauritius has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

The Fiscal Decentralization dataset includes fiscal decentralization indicators for a sample of IMF member countries. The following indicators are included in the dataset: Revenue and Expenditure Decentralization Shares; Transfer dependency and Vertical Fiscal Imbalances; Deficit and Debt; Allocation of expenditure (economic classification); Allocation of expenditure (functional classification); Allocation of non-Tax Revenues; and Allocation of Taxes.
